Toshio Nakashima
About
Toshio Nakashima has authored 5 papers that have received a total of 679 indexed citations.
This includes 3 papers in Materials Chemistry, 3 papers in Polymers and Plastics and 2 papers in Renewable Energy, Sustainability and the Environment. The topics of these papers are Conducting polymers and applications (3 papers), Quantum Dots Synthesis And Properties (2 papers) and TiO2 Photocatalysis and Solar Cells (2 papers). Toshio Nakashima is often cited by papers focused on Conducting polymers and applications (3 papers), Quantum Dots Synthesis And Properties (2 papers) and TiO2 Photocatalysis and Solar Cells (2 papers) and collaborates with scholars based in Japan. Toshio Nakashima's co-authors include Norifusa Satoh, Kimihisa Yamamoto, M. Soledade C. Pedras, Ken Albrecht and Janet L. Taylor and has published in prestigious journals such as Journal of the American Chemical Society, Chemistry of Materials and Nature Nanotechnology.
